About The Role
The Commercial PC Segments organization is seeking an experienced leader to drive strategic get to market programs for commercial client platforms. This role partners with internal teams, customers, OEMs, and end users to showcase and evaluate Intel's latest commercial client solutions. The successful candidate will bring strong expertise across hardware, software, and enterprise IT systems, and will lead hands on engagements that provide customers with a seamless way to experience Intel and partner solutions. The role also owns the development of enterprise focused content that resonates with IT decision makers.
A highly qualified candidate will exhibit the following behavior traits:
- Exceptional collaboration skills and a strong execution mindset
- Executive level communication skills with the ability to simplify complex topics
- Sound judgment and effective decision making
- Consistent, detail oriented customer follow through
Qualifications
Minimum qualifications are required to be initially considered for this position. Preferred qualifications are in addition to the minimum requirements and are considered a plus factor in identifying top candidates.
Minimum Qualifications
- Bachelor’s Degree and 5 years’ experience in the electrical engineering, software engineering, semiconductor, project management or other related discipline.
- 5 years of technical, customer facing experience as a program or project manager.
- 5 years of experience with IT deployment methodologies, including client deployment, network and server infrastructure, cloud, and firewall technologies.
- Deep understanding of the PC market, key customers and partners, performance metrics, and industry trends.
- Strong knowledge of enterprise IT systems and capabilities.
- Proven ability to define and execute growth strategies at scale.
- Demonstrated influence and effectiveness in a matrixed organization.

Annual Salary Range for jobs which could be performed in the US: $120,320.00 - 236,810.00 USD
The range displayed on this job posting reflects the minimum and maximum target compensation for the position across all US locations. Within the range, individual pay is determined by work location and additional factors, including job-related skills, experience, and relevant education or training. Your recruiter can share more about the specific compensation range for your preferred location during the hiring process.
